c语言中不合法的字符常量是

来源:学生作业帮助网 编辑:作业帮 时间:2024/07/14 23:38:35
C语言中下列常量不合法的是

(6)0x3.60x开头这是个16进制数,16进制数没有小数形式,后面不能是3.6这种(10)E-10要用小写e(11)0x2e-6同第一条,e是个小数(12)4.2e这个没有原因,格式不对,正常应该

【C语言,为什么'\ff1'是不合法的常量】

C语言中常量的命名原则中有:只能是数字,字母,下划线组成并且开头是字母或者是下划线,你的第一个字符时"\"是不合理的哦.

1.C语言中下列不合法的字符变量是:

1、A因为'\xff'表示16进制的ff,它的值超过了字符变量能表示的最大范围2、结果应该是1,首先判断getchar()=='A',因为输入的也是'A',所以相等,结果是“真”,用1表示,然后赋值给

为什么-028是不合法的常量?

-028在C/C++中是数据的八进制表示方法(数据前有0).而八进制的每个数为范围为从0到7,不会有8.所以,是不合法的常量.

(2)在C语言中,合法的字符常量是( ) A)'\084' B) '\x43' C)'ab' D) "\0"

字符常量是用单引号括起来的一个字符.有两种表示方法:一种是用该字符的图形符号,如'b','y','*'.另外还可以用字符的ASCII码表示,即用反斜符(\)开头,后跟字符的ASCII码,这种方法也称为

以下不合法的常量是:A.10^2B.100C.100.0D.10E01

答案:A再问:为什么呀??我不懂耶再答:计算机常量:题目中的4个选择都为数值常量,其中A是数学中指数表示形式,但在VB中用答案D格式书写的。所以A是错的。

3.以下选项中,不合法的C语言数值常量是( ) (A)028 (B)12.(C).177 (D)0x8A

A以中默认以0开头的是八进制数,八进制中怎么会有8呢,最大的是7,0x开头的是十六进制数,B、C是十进制数、都没错

下列常量中,不合法的常量是 .A) ‘\0’ B) 0xfb9 C)

d不合法,它表示8进制,里面不能有8

C语言中,下列不合法的字符常量是

首先看定义,用单引号括起来的单个字符,或用双引号括起来的一串字符即字符常量.C'&'是用单引号括起来的单个字符,正确.A'\xff'B'\65'D'\028'是用单引号括起来的多个字符,但因它们前面都

关于c语言编程选择题:下列数据中哪些不属于字符常量的是?A.'\xff' b.'\160' c.'070' d.070

满意答案大成至圣5级2011-12-08此题的正确答案是C,分析如下:A.'\xff'以反斜杠('\')开头,表明是转义字符,第二位为'x',按规定后跟两个字符'ff'表示两位十六进制数,也就是说此字

lg3为什么是不合法的C语言常量?

//下面是参考例子.#include#includevoidmain(){printf("%f%f\n",log10(3.0),log(3.0));}

关于C语言的题,下列选项中不正确的字符常量是() A) '\\' B)'\'' C)'074' D)'\xaa'

A转义字符,就是反斜线字符\B转义字符,就是单引号字符'C错误,内容是3个字符,如果是'\074'则是正确的8进制转义D16进制转义,ascii值为10*16+10正确

C语言中下列选项中,非法的字符常量是() A) '\t' B) '\17' C) "\n" D)'\xaa'

A跳格字符B8进制转义ascii码为8+7=15C字符串常量,不是字符常量D16进制转义ascii码为10*16+10=170

关于c语言编程选择题:下列数据中哪些不属于字符常量的是? A.'\xff' b.'\160' c.'070' d.070

此题的正确答案是C,分析如下:A.'\xff'以反斜杠('\')开头,表明是转义字符,第二位为'x',按规定后跟两个字符'ff'表示两位十六进制数,也就是说此字符的ASCII码对应十六进制数0xff,

C语言的一道题:以下不合法的字符常量是()A.'\2' B.'"' c.' ' D.'\483' 问一下该选哪一项,为什

D因为''里面要是字符,而字符只能从'\0'到'\255';所以说'\483'是不合法的字符常量.

在C语言中,#define PI 3.14115 是将PI定义为() A 符号常量 B字符常量 C实型常量 D变量

应该是C.首先肯定把PI定义成常量,排除D;因为在之后的程序里可以直接用PI来进行计算,符号和字符不能直接计算,所以选C

C语言中字符常量'\xA2'对应的数值为什么是102.

之所以用C语言运行出来是因为你肯定用了char类型字符.(最大值是127)char类型字符是有符号类型,‘\xA2’转为二进制则是:10100010(最高位为1,意味着这个是一个负数).获取负数的绝对

为什么'800'这个c常量是不合法的.

'800'不是一个字符当然不合法"800"应该算是一个字符串